Clifford F.
Stritch is the founder of Infinite Graphics, Inc. He held the title of President starting in 2015.
Mr. Stritch is also the founder of Man Machine Interface.

Commercial Printing/FormsCommercial Services Infinite Graphics, Inc. is a photolithography company, which engages in the provision of photomasks, 3D microstructures, phototools, precision imaging software and optical engineering. Its products and services include Solder paste Stencil, RIP/OEM, Precision Graphics, 3D Structures and Legacy. The company was founded by Clifford F. Stritch Jr. in 1969 and is headquartered in Minneapolis, MN. | Commercial Services |

Man Machine Interface Computer CommunicationsElectronic Technology Part of ITT, Inc., Man Machine Interface is an American company that develops and manufactures switch arrays and keypads for mobile phones. The company is based in OH. The company was founded by Clifford F. Stritch.
